The Woodstock Academy is an independent town academy providing college preparatory classes for grades 9-12 and Post Graduates. The school serves six sending towns and admits students from countries all over the world.

Tell me a bit about Woodstock Academy.
Woodstock Academy is Co-ed private boarding school located in Connecticut, US. It was founded 1801, and currently has about 1050 students, 10.00% of whom are international students.

What is the application requirement for Woodstock Academy?
Similar to most private schools in the US, Woodstock Academy’s typical admission requirements include school transcript, recommendation letter, application essay, standard test (like TOEFL and SSAT), and interview (often optional, but highly recommended).

What is the latest tuition for Woodstock Academy’s Co-ed student?
The total fee for Woodstock Academy in 2024 is $61,700 , which typically includes tuition, boarding fee, student management fee and a few other fees associated with managing international students.
